Nine Vehicles Stolen From Knowlsey Property

Bendigo Crime Investigation Unit detectives are appealing for public assistance after nine vehicles and property were stolen from a farm in Knowlsey last month.

It is believed unknown offenders attended the rural property on Tunnecliffs Lane between 12 October and 24 October while the occupants were away.

During the 12-day period, offenders attended and stole over $150,000 of items, including:

• a grey 1993 Mazda Bravo ute, registration FBZ077

• a red Sami tractor

• a Suzuki 200 motorcycle

• a Honda CR80 motorcycle

• a Yamaha Pwee 50 motorcycle

• a Yamaha 350 quad bike

• two Yamaha 85 mini quad bikes

• a ride on lawn mower

• an air compressor

• gardening tools, including a leaf blower and whipper snipper

• a number of tools including chainsaws, drills, a circular saw, an angle grinder and multiple socket sets

• three registered trailers including a camper trailer, a silver tandem trailer and a black 6x4 trailer

Investigators believe most items were stolen on 19 October, with the tractor driven away about 10pm.

The offenders also gained entry to the house, taking items including:

• two televisions

• three kitchen bench chairs

• a coffee table

• two paintings

• multiple bottles of wine, as well as a wine fridge

Investigators have released images of two of the stolen vehicles in the hope someone may know of their whereabouts.
